Web11 Jan 2024 · Symptoms and Treatment of TFCC. The most common symptoms of a TFCC injury or tear are pain in your wrist on the pinky side, with a clicking or popping sound when moving your wrist or rotating your forearm. Web16 Sep 2016 · As the wrist becomes more ulnar positive, the ulnocarpal joint experiences increased forces leading to ulnar-sided wrist pain. Ulnar positivity can be a normal anatomic variant, the result of distal radius physeal arrest (so-called gymnast’s wrist), or as a dynamic condition with grip and pronation [ 26 , 27 ].
